Xuguang Yang
About
Xuguang Yang has authored 31 papers that have received a total of 420 indexed citations.
This includes 21 papers in Computational Mechanics, 11 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 9 papers in Biomedical Engineering. The topics of these papers are Lattice Boltzmann Simulation Studies (17 papers), Aerosol Filtration and Electrostatic Precipitation (8 papers) and Nanofluid Flow and Heat Transfer (8 papers). Xuguang Yang is often cited by papers focused on Lattice Boltzmann Simulation Studies (17 papers), Aerosol Filtration and Electrostatic Precipitation (8 papers) and Nanofluid Flow and Heat Transfer (8 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in China, Hong Kong and Nigeria. Xuguang Yang's co-authors include Zhenhua Chai, Baochang Shi, Liyao Xie, Chunhua Min and Zhonghua Qiao and has published in prestigious journals such as International Journal of Heat and Mass Transfer, Energy Conversion and Management and IEEE Access.
